Specifications
Capacity: 75 ml (2.5 oz)
Material: High Borosilicate Glass
Features:
• Double pour spout for left or right-handed use
• Heat-resistant and espresso machine friendly
• Wooden handle for a cool, comfortable grip
• Clear measurement markings for accuracy
Use: Espresso transfer, milk measuring, shot prep

Care Instruction
Hand wash only.
Do not microwave due to wooden handle.
Avoid soaking handle in water.
Dry thoroughly after use.
